Polymer Dosing Process Description

The Or-Tec BLEND Polymer Dosing System is used extensively in the water and waste water treatment industry for the activation, blending and dosing of emulsion polymer as a solution.

The Or-Tec BLEND is designed for the activation, blending and dosing of polymer as a solution without any mechanical mixing.

Incoming dilution water is regulated by a flow control meter and is then passed through an injection block. Polymer is drawn from its container and injected through the injection block by a metering pump.

High water velocities through the injection block instantly activate the emulsion polymer. From there, the solution flows to a retention vessel for further mixing and activation.

The retention vessel has a unique vortex system at its inlet. This vortex system uses the hydraulic energy of the polymer/water solution to actively mix and further activate the solution. The retention vessel also allows the polymer solution to age.

The activated / blended solution is now ready for use.
